ROCKWOOD CITY STREETS UNDERGOING ADA RECONSTRUCTION
If you’ve traveled along Gateway Avenue in Rockwood over the past week or so, you may have noticed that sidewalk entrances from city streets are being reconstructed. This work is part of a Tennessee Department of Transportation initiative using ADA compliance funds to upgrade sidewalks requiring accessibility improvements.
According to city officials, Gateway Avenue is also scheduled for resurfacing later this year, necessitating the completion of the new sidewalk entrances beforehand. The Tennessee Department of Transportation has contracted the work, and progress is underway—over half of the sidewalk entrances have already been repaired, with efforts now focused on the next four intersections.
Pedestrians using the sidewalks should note that wet concrete may be present at times and are advised to avoid those sections until the signage is removed.
